Parking Attendants in Nevada earn a median salary of $29,750 per year ($2,479/month).
This is 9.6% below the national average of $32,914.
Nevada ranks #45 out of 51 states for Parking Attendants pay.
Approximately 2,660 people work in this occupation across Nevada.
Salaries increased by 0.7% compared to 2024.
About This Job: Parking Attendants
Park vehicles or issue tickets for customers in a parking lot or garage. May park or tend vehicles in environments such as a car dealership or rental car facility. May collect fee.

Salaries for Parking Attendants in Nevada range from $25,290 at the 10th percentile (entry level) to $42,870 at the 90th percentile (experienced). The middle 50% earn between $27,010 and $36,810.

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2025 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.
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
